Tom Lane [Mon, 31 May 2004 18:32:23 +0000 (18:32 +0000)]
I think I've finally identified the cause of the off-by-one-second
issue in timestamp conversion that we hacked around for so long by
ignoring the seconds field from localtime(). It's simple: you have
to watch out for platform-specific roundoff error when reducing a
possibly-fractional timestamp to integral time_t form. In particular
we should subtract off the already-determined fractional fsec field.
This should be enough to get an exact answer with int64 timestamps;
with float timestamps, throw in a rint() call just to be sure.

Tom Lane [Sat, 22 May 2004 21:58:41 +0000 (21:58 +0000)]
Reduce pg_listener lock taken by NOTIFY et al from AccessExclusiveLock
to ExclusiveLock. This still serializes the operations of this module,
but doesn't conflict with concurrent ANALYZE operations. Per trouble
report from Philip Warner a few weeks ago.

Tom Lane [Sun, 18 Apr 2004 18:13:31 +0000 (18:13 +0000)]
Tweak findTargetlistEntry so that bare names occurring in GROUP BY clauses
are sought first as local FROM columns, then as local SELECT-list aliases,
and finally as outer FROM columns; the former behavior made outer FROM
columns take precedence over aliases. This does not change spec
conformance because SQL99 allows only the first case anyway, and it seems
more useful and self-consistent. Per gripe from Dennis Bjorklund 2004-04-05.

Tom Lane [Sat, 13 Mar 2004 00:54:35 +0000 (00:54 +0000)]
Repair memory leakage introduced into the non-hashed aggregate case by
7.4 rewrite for hashed aggregate support. If the transition data type
is pass-by-reference, the transValue must be pfreed when starting a new
group boundary, else we have a one-value-per-group leakage. Thanks to
Rae Steining for providing a reproducible test case.
